Top Services Offered by Custom Home Builders in Utah

A professional custom builder in Utah typically offers end-to-end services, including:

1. Lot Evaluation & Selection

Not all land is equal. Builders help evaluate slopes, soil, zoning, and utility access to ensure a smooth construction process.

2. Architectural Design

Many custom home builders offer in-house design or work closely with architects to create unique, buildable plans that meet your goals and local code.

3. Permitting & Approvals

Utah has strict building codes and regional regulations. Builders handle permitting, inspections, and HOA coordination where applicable.

4. Construction & Project Management

From foundation to finish work, experienced teams manage trades, timelines, and budgets while keeping you informed every step of the way.

5. Interior Design & Finish Selection

You’ll choose flooring, cabinetry, lighting, countertops, paint, and fixtures — making the home distinctly yours.

6. Post-Construction Support

Reliable builders offer warranties, maintenance advice, and follow-up support after you move in.

Where to Build Custom Homes in Utah

The state offers a variety of ideal locations for building your custom dream home, such as:

  • Salt Lake City & Suburbs – Access to jobs, top schools, and urban amenities
  • Provo/Orem Area – A tech-driven region with family-oriented neighborhoods
  • St. George – Warm climate, red rock views, and golf course communities
  • Park City – Luxury living with mountain scenery and ski-in/ski-out homes
  • Logan & Northern Utah – Affordable lots with peaceful, scenic surroundings

Each area has its own building regulations and land costs, which your builder will navigate.

Estimated Cost of a Custom Home in Utah

Building a custom home can vary widely in cost depending on location, design, and finishes. Here’s a general breakdown:

  • Standard custom homes: $180–$250 per sq. ft.
  • Luxury custom homes: $250–$400+ per sq. ft.
  • Typical home size: 2,000–5,000 sq. ft.
  • Total estimated budget: $400,000 to $1.5M+
